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We send a trained technician to inspect the affected area and assess the extent of the damage.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and identify the source of the problem.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use advanced equipment to extract water from the crawl space, including wet/dry vacuums and dehumidifiers. We work qu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We use specialized equipment to dry the crawl space thoroughly, including air movers and dehumidifiers. We work to remove all excess moisture to prevent further damage.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
We repair any damaged insulation, flooring, or structural elements to ensure that your crawl space is safe and secure. We use high-quality materials and work to match the original condition of the area.

Crawl Space Water Removal Cost In Metairie, LA
The cost of crawl space water removal in Metairie, LA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works closely with insurance companies to ensure a smooth cla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Insulation repair or repl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of insulation, and extent of damage. |
| Flooring repair or replacement | $1,500 – $7,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and extent of damage. |
| Structural repair or replacement |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of structure, and extent of damage. |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and extent of damage. |
| Dehumidification and ventilation |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ed. |

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Removal
How long does it take to dry a crawl space?
The time it takes to dry a crawl space dep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the equipment used. Our team works quickly to reduce downtime and ensure that your crawl space is safe and secure.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to dry a crawl space, but this can vary depending on the situation.
What causes crawl space water damage?
Crawl space water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, sump pump failure, and clogged gutters. It’s essential to be aware of these warning signs and take action quickly to prevent further damage.
Is crawl space water removal covered by insurance?
Yes, crawl space water removal is typically covered by homeowners insurance. Our team works closely with insurance companies to ensure a smooth claims process and help you get the compensation you deserve.
How do I prevent crawl space water damage?
Preventing crawl space water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Our team recommends checking your crawl space regularly for signs of water damage and addressing any issues quickly. Also, consider installing a sump pump and checking your gutters regularly to prevent clogs.
What equipment do you use for crawl space water removal?
We use advanced equipment, including wet/dry vacuums, dehumidifiers, and air movers, to extract water from the crawl space and dry the area thoroughly. Our team is trained to use this equipment effectively and efficiently to reduce downtime and ensure that your crawl space is safe and secure.
